Signs It’s Time to Replace Your Air Conditioner

As summer approaches, your air conditioner becomes one of the most important appliances in your home. But if your AC unit struggles to keep up with the heat, it might be time for a replacement. Replacing an air conditioner before it completely breaks down can save you from costly repairs, high energy bills, and uncomfortable summer days.

If you’re unsure whether to repair or replace your AC, here are the key signs that indicate it’s time for an upgrade.

1. Your AC is More Than 10-15 Years Old

Most air conditioners have a lifespan of 10 to 15 years. If your system is within this range, it may no longer run as efficiently as newer models. Older units often require more repairs and use outdated technology, leading to higher energy bills and inconsistent cooling.

Newer air conditioners are designed to be more energy-efficient, saving you money in the long run while providing better cooling performance.

2. Frequent Repairs Are Adding Up

If you’ve had to call for AC repairs multiple times in the past year, it may be more cost-effective to replace the system. Repairs can quickly add up, and you could end up spending more on fixing an aging unit than you would on a new, energy-efficient system.

Ask yourself:

  • Have you had to replace major components like the compressor or condenser?
  • Have you had multiple refrigerant leaks?
  • Are you spending more on repairs than your AC is worth?

If you answered yes, replacement may be the best option.

3. Your Energy Bills Are Increasing

A sudden or gradual increase in your energy bills could be a sign that your air conditioner is losing efficiency. As AC units age, they have to work harder to cool your home, using more energy in the process.

Upgrading to a high-efficiency air conditioner can significantly reduce energy costs while keeping your home more comfortable. Look for models with a high S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) rating for the best efficiency.

4. Uneven Cooling or Weak Airflow

Are some rooms in your home cooler than others? Do you notice weak airflow from your vents? These could be signs that your air conditioner is no longer functioning at full capacity.

Poor cooling performance can be caused by:

  • A failing compressor
  • Leaky or blocked ducts
  • An aging system struggling to distribute air evenly

If you’ve tried basic troubleshooting, such as replacing the air filter and checking for blocked vents, but still experience uneven cooling, your AC may be failing.

5. Your AC Uses R-22 Refrigerant (Freon)

If your air conditioner was installed before 2010, it may still use R-22 refrigerant, also known as Freon. The production of R-22 has been phased out due to environmental concerns, making it expensive and difficult to replace.

Newer AC systems use R454B refrigerant, which is more efficient and environmentally friendly. If your system still relies on R-22, now is a good time to consider an upgrade.

6. Your Home Feels Humid, Even When the AC is Running

A properly functioning air conditioner not only cools your home but also controls humidity levels. If your home feels humid or sticky even when the AC is on, it could indicate that the system is:

  • Too old to properly regulate moisture
  • Improperly sized for your home
  • Losing efficiency due to worn-out components

High indoor humidity can lead to mold growth and decreased air quality, making a replacement a smart choice for both comfort and health.

7. Your AC is Making Strange Noises

If your air conditioner is making grinding, banging, rattling, or squealing noises, it could be a sign of serious internal issues. While some sounds may indicate a loose or broken part, others can signal motor failure or compressor problems, which are costly to repair.

If your AC has become significantly louder or is making unusual noises, it’s worth having a professional inspect it to determine if replacement is necessary.
